H5唤起APP不迷路:应用市场和应用详情页跳转的全攻略
2023-10-12 14:02:07
在移动互联网时代,H5页面已经成为一种常见的信息传播方式。随着移动设备的普及,人们越来越习惯于使用手机访问信息。因此,H5页面与APP之间的交互就变得越来越重要。
H5唤起APP是指在H5页面上,用户点击打开app按钮,在用户手机上已经安装了App时,打开app,否则就引导用户前往应用市场。这样就方便了用户,而且在业务需要情况下,可以跳转到app指定页面和传参。
iOS系统H5唤起APP
在iOS系统中,H5唤起APP有两种方式:
1. 使用应用市场跳转
这种方式是最简单的,只需要在H5页面中添加一个链接,指向App在App Store中的下载页面。当用户点击这个链接时,如果用户手机上已经安装了App,就会直接打开App;如果没有安装,就会跳转到App Store的下载页面。
<a href="https://apps.apple.com/app/id1234567890">打开App</a>
2. 使用应用详情页跳转
这种方式与应用市场跳转类似,但可以跳转到App在App Store中的详情页。当用户点击这个链接时,如果用户手机上已经安装了App,就会直接打开App;如果没有安装,就会跳转到App Store的详情页。
<a href="https://apps.apple.com/app/id1234567890?mt=8">打开App</a>
安卓系统H5唤起APP
在安卓系统中,H5唤起APP有三种方式:
1. 使用应用市场跳转
这种方式与iOS系统中的应用市场跳转类似,只需要在H5页面中添加一个链接,指向App在Google Play中的下载页面。当用户点击这个链接时,如果用户手机上已经安装了App,就会直接打开App;如果没有安装,就会跳转到Google Play的下载页面。
<a href="https://play.google.com/store/apps/details?id=com.example.app">打开App</a>
2. 使用应用详情页跳转
这种方式与iOS系统中的应用详情页跳转类似,但可以跳转到App在Google Play中的详情页。当用户点击这个链接时,如果用户手机上已经安装了App,就会直接打开App;如果没有安装,就会跳转到Google Play的详情页。
<a href="https://play.google.com/store/apps/details?id=com.example.app&referrer=utm_source%3Dgoogle%26utm_medium%3Dorganic">打开App</a>
3. 使用App原生跳转
这种方式需要在App中实现一个H5唤起APP的接口,并在H5页面中调用这个接口。当用户点击打开app按钮时,H5页面会调用这个接口,App收到这个接口调用后,就会直接打开App。
这种方式的好处是,可以跳转到App的指定页面,而且可以传参。但是,这种方式需要在App中实现一个H5唤起APP的接口,因此需要一定的开发成本。
总结
本文介绍了H5唤起APP的各种解决方案,包括在iOS和安卓系统中使用应用市场跳转、应用详情页跳转和App原生跳转的方法。并提供了详细的步骤和示例代码,帮助您轻松实现H5唤起APP的功能。